Wanda Lois Bird (Hardy), 90, of Greenwood, Indiana, passed away peacefully at home on February 18, 2025, surrounded by her loving family and her Pastor. She was married to Richard E. Bird, her husband of 70 years. Wanda was born on October 14, 1934, in Salem, Indiana and was the daughter to Bessie and Eugene Martin.
Wanda was a devoted wife, mother, and servant of the Lord. She worked alongside her mother and stepfather as a tile-setter and later became the proud owner of Birds and Bees Flower Shop. She and Richard were faithful members of Greenwood Bible Baptist Church where they dedicated many years to ministry. Wanda was actively involved in various ministries including the visitation ministry, the bus ministry, and they loved teaching the 5th-grade girls Sunday School class. Together they touched countless lives with their kindness and unwavering faith.
Wanda and Richard were married on July 27, 1954, and recently celebrated their 70th wedding anniversary. Richard served in the U.S. Navy and Naval Reserves before they began their life together.
Wanda is survived by her loving husband, Richard E. Bird; daughter Lesa West (Bird) and husband Terry West; and son Michael Bird and wife Sheila Bird (Siefert). She had 8 grandchildren and 7 great-grandchildren. Wanda was preceded in death by her beloved daughter, Deborah L. Morrison (Bird), in 2007.
